Machining parts on vertical CNC machine tools mainly depends on the machining program. Unlike ordinary machine tools, it does not require manufacturing, changing many molds and fixtures, and does not require frequent readjustment of the machine tool. Therefore, vertical CNC machine tools are suitable for places where the processed parts are frequently changed, that is, suitable for the consumption of single pieces, small batch products, and new products, thereby shortening the consumption preparation cycle and saving a lot of process equipment costs.
The machining accuracy of vertical CNC machine tools can generally reach 0.05-0.1mm. Vertical CNC machine tools are controlled by digital signals. When the CNC installation outputs a pulse signal, the moving parts of the machine tool move by a pulse equivalent (usually 0.001mm). Moreover, the reverse clearance of the machine tool feed transmission chain and the uniform error of the screw pitch can be compensated by the CNC installation stop curve. Therefore, the positioning accuracy of vertical CNC machine tools is relatively high.
Vertical CNC machine tools can reduce the processing time and auxiliary time of parts. The spindle speed and feed rate range of vertical CNC machine tools are large, allowing the machine tool to stop cutting with large cutting amounts. Vertical CNC machine tools are entering the era of high-speed machining, and the movement and positioning of moving parts and high-speed cutting processing of vertical CNC machine tools have greatly improved the consumption rate. In addition, when used in conjunction with the tool magazine of the machining center, continuous processing of multiple processes can be stopped on one machine tool, reducing the turnover time between processes for semi-finished products and improving consumption rates.
Before processing, the vertical CNC machine tool is adjusted, input the program and start, and the machine tool will automatically stop processing continuously until it is completed. The operator only needs to do tasks such as program input, editing, part loading and unloading, tool preparation, observation of machining status, and inspection of parts. The labor intensity is greatly reduced, and the labor of machine tool operators tends towards intellectual work. In addition, machine tools are usually separated, which is both clean and safe.
